There are 752 VAUXHALL vehicles affected by the recall R/2014/178.
This recall was issued on January 23rd, 2015 and all the details of this VAUXHALL recall (R/2014/178 - SEAT BELT MAY OPEN INADVERTENTLY IN THE EVENT OF A CRASH) are provided bellow:

SEAT BELT MAY OPEN INADVERTENTLY IN THE EVENT OF A CRASH
The buckles on seat belts fitted to the 2nd row of seats may have a weakness created during the manufacturing process. This weakness may allow the buckle to inadvertently open during a collision.
On affected vehicles check the traceability codes of the 2nd row seat belts. Replace those belts which have an affected code.
Contact the local VAUXHALL dealership or manufacturer. You will not need to pay for anything involving the recall.
The Recalled vehicles will have the fixing checked and corrected as necessary by and official VAUXHALL service.
